Grand-Place
Arrive at the magnificent Grand Place, one of Europe's most beautiful squares. Pause to admire the Baroque houses that rose from the ashes of the 1695 French artillery onslaught. Immerse yourself in the grandeur of this iconic location.

La Fleur en Papier Doré
Walk past Café La Fleur en Papier Doré, a historic meeting place for Surrealist artists. Though not a stopping point, it encapsulates Brussels' association with artistic movements.
